Tax Debts and Reductions






Recognizing the nuances of tax credits and deductions is essential for enhancing economic results. Tax credit histories straight reduce the quantity of tax bay area tax services obligation owed, while deductions lower taxed earnings. This difference is significant; for circumstances, a $1,000 tax credit scores reduces your tax obligation bill by $1,000, whereas a $1,000 reduction reduces your gross income by that quantity, which causes a smaller tax obligation reduction relying on your tax bracket.

Tax obligation credit ratings can be classified right into nonrefundable and refundable - Online tax return. Nonrefundable credit scores can just decrease your tax obligation to zero, while refundable credit scores may result in a Tax refund exceeding your tax obligation owed. Typical tax credit histories include the Earned Income Tax Credit Scores and the Kid Tax Credit report, both intended at sustaining people and households


Reductions, on the various other hand, can be made a list of or taken as a common deduction. Making a list of allows taxpayers to checklist eligible expenses such as home mortgage interest and medical prices, whereas the typical deduction supplies a set deduction quantity based upon filing standing.
